Foundation crack repair services involve identifying and addressing cracks that develop in a building’s foundation. These cracks can vary in size and severity, ranging from small surface fractures to larger structural splits. The repair process typically includes inspecting the affected areas, determining the underlying cause of the cracks, and implementing appropriate solutions such as epoxy injections, polyurethane foam, or underpinning techniques. The goal is to stabilize the foundation, prevent further damage, and restore the structural integrity of the property.
Cracks in foundations are often caused by factors such as soil movement, settling, or moisture fluctuations. Left unaddressed, these cracks can lead to more serious issues like uneven flooring, doors and windows that stick, or even significant structural failure. Foundation crack repair services help mitigate these problems by sealing existing cracks and reinforcing the foundation, thereby reducing the risk of further deterioration. Cost Range for Crack Repair - The typical cost for foundation crack repair varies between $500 and $2,500, depending on the severity and size of the crack. For example, minor cracks may cost around $500, while larger or more severe cracks can approach $2,500 or more.
Factors Influencing Costs - Repair costs are influenced by the extent of the damage, the type of foundation, and the method used. Simple crack injections might be on the lower end of the cost spectrum, whereas extensive repairs could increase expenses significantly.
Average Service Expenses - On average, homeowners in Allendale, MI, can expect to pay between $1,000 and $3,000 for professional foundation crack repair. Exact prices will vary based on the specific circumstances of each property.
Additional Cost Considerations - Additional costs may include foundation assessment, preparation work, and potential structural reinforcement. Local service providers can provide detailed estimates based on the property's condition and repair need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es foundation cracks? Foundation cracks can result from soil movement, settling, or moisture changes that create stress on the foundation structure.
Are all foundation cracks a sign of serious issues? Not all cracks indicate major problems; some are cosmetic, but it's advisable to have a professional assess any crack to determine its significance.
How do professionals repair foundation cracks? Repair methods vary and may include sealing, epoxy injections, or underpinning, depending on the crack's size and cause.
How can I tell if a crack needs repair? Signs that a crack may require repair include widening, vertical movement, or if it affects doors and windows functioning properly.
